Immigration Medical Exam Requirements

Prior to receiving lawful copyright in the United States, all individuals must undergo a comprehensive medical examination. This exam is conducted by a certified Civil Surgeon and aims to ensure that newcomers do not pose a public health risk. During the exam, the physician will assess your medical history, perform a physical examination, and perform certain screenings as necessary. Specific criteria may vary depending on the individual's age, health condition, and origin.

  • Common tests often entail a chest x-ray, blood tests, and a physical check for signs of contagious diseases.
  • Furthermore, the physician will assess you for certain conditions that may be contagious and pose a danger to public health.

It is vital to furnish the physician with a complete and truthful medical history. Failure to do so may lead delays in your citizenship process.
